Medical offices process protected health information (PHI) every day. Recent data from Healthcare IT News in 2023 indicates that nearly 87% of practices routinely manage PHI through telephone interactions. These calls often include personal details such as patient names, dates of birth, medical conditions, and insurance information. A notable case in Michigan saw a practice fined close to $175,000 after test results were inadvertently disclosed to the wrong recipient because the system did not verify caller identity.

Deciding on a secure phone system involves careful consideration of several factors:
When evaluating systems, confirm that the solution uses end-to-end encryption and supports multi-factor authentication. Look for certifications such as PCI DSS and SOC 2. Our system is built on AES-256 encryption, a widely recognized standard for protecting sensitive data.
The ideal solution should integrate effortlessly with your current EHR/EMR systems. With encrypted API endpoints and regular security testing, our voice agent system ensures that patient data flows securely between platforms, maintaining integrity and confidentiality.
The financial risks associated with HIPAA violations are significant. With average fines around $42,530 per incident in 2023, investing in a secure system is a strategic decision.
